The ToxiLight® BioAssay Kit is a bioluminescent, non-destructive cytolysis assay kit designed to measure the release of the enzyme, adenylate kinase (AK), from damaged cells.

The ToxiLight BioAssay Kit also facilitates high content screening by allowing other tests to be performed on the original cells For example, the ToxiLight BioAssay Kit is fully compatible with the ReportaLight™ BioAssay Kit, thus facilitating measurement of cytotoxicity and gene expression in the same sample.

All the components required for AK detection are contained within a single reagent making the assay very simple to perform. The kit provides outstanding sensitivity with a detection limit of 10 cells per microwell with a dynamic range of over 5 orders of magnitude. Extended signal stability also makes the assay suitable for batch processing in high-throughput screening applications.

  • Highly sensitive—The ToxiLight BioAssay Kit exploits the cyclic nature of the AK reaction whereby a small amount of the AK enzyme can generate high concentrations of ATP. This enables the detection of very subtle changes in cytotoxicity and reduces false negatives.
  • Non-destructive—ToxiLight assay detects cellular AK present in cell culture supernatants, eliminating the need to lyse cells to perform the assay, and allowing multiple tests to be performed on the same sample.
  • Simple—Assay requires the simple addition of a single reagent, which can be added directly to wells in which cells are growing, or to a small sample of aspirated culture supernatant.
  • Fast —Readable signal is detectable 5 minutes after the addition of the ToxiLight BioAssay reagent.
  • Flexible—Cell supernatants can be frozen with no loss of AK activity, allowing for long-term kinetic studies. Safe—No hazardous chemicals are required.
